Transaction 531be75556a1b01882bb31e79b467683a43e8342e3edaaa85a338cbb01fd7a67
1 Input
1 Output
-
531be75556a1b01882bb31e79b467683a43e8342e3edaaa85a338cbb01fd7a67:0
- value
- 2686586
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a01da0f3c0071593ca9b4ea81f2dbcdb6ef2b45
- address
- bc1qdgqa5reuqpc4j09fkn4grukmekmw7269sejmwk